About Brie Larson in Elektra


As old as time itself, this is one of the most highly anticipated releases of 2025! The first revival in over a decade of Sophocles' tragedy - originally written between 420 and 414 BC - sees Oklahoma! frontman Daniel Fish directing superstar Brie Larson, who you may know from her roles in blockbusters such as Room and Captain Marvel. Award-winning poet Anne Carson lends her voice as narrator.

The story follows Electra, tormented by the brutal murder of her father. Consumed by overwhelming grief, a fierce will to endure, and an unrelenting thirst for revenge, she is driven to the brink. When her long-lost brother, Orestes, finally returns, she urges him toward a chilling and violent resolution - but at what cost?

About Billy Poter In CabareT

Now that's fabulous!

Kinky Boots and Pose icon, activist, actor, and all-around entertainment powerhouse Billy Porter will step into the role of the Emcee from 28 January 2025, joining Marisha Wallace as Sally Bowles on the same date.

The seven-time Olivier Award-winning revival is still going strong - daring, bold, and everything you could hope for from the Kander and Ebb classic. This immersive production takes place in the specially adapted Playhouse Theatre, bringing to life the story of an American writer and an entrancing showgirl who find themselves in Weimar-era Berlin as the shadow of fascism looms over the country.

The artists, creatives, freaks, and outcasts must fight to seize every last moment of freedom before the rise of the Nazis change their world forever
